Question - The balances of select accounts of McMurray, Inc. as of December 31, 2024 are given below:

Notes Payable-short - term $1,500

Salaries Payable 6,000

Notes Payable-long-term 20,000

Accounts Payable 3,000

Unearned Revenue 2,000

Interest Payable 2,500

The Unearned Revenue is the amount of cash received for services to be rendered in January 2025. Interest Payable will be paid on February 5, 2025. What are the total long-term liabilities shown on the balance sheet at December 31, 2024?
